California Man Identified in Deadly Road Rage Shooting in Las Vegas

Authorities in Las Vegas have identified a 58-year-old tourist killed in what police called a vehicle-to-vehicle "road rage" shooting on Interstate 15.

The Clark County coroner said Monday that Jeffrey Kay Boyajian of Lake Elsinore, California, was pronounced dead late Aug. 5 at University Medical Center of multiple gunshots to the chest. His death was ruled a homicide.

The Las Vegas Review-Journal reports that Boyajian was headed to Las Vegas to celebrate his birthday.

No arrests have been made.

Police said the shooter was in a white van that pulled alongside Boyajian's vehicle not far from the Blue Diamond Road exit, a few miles south of the Las Vegas Strip.

Las Vegas police have circulated video showing the white van on and exiting the freeway.
